A key battle on the MLB betting odds menu sees the visiting Pittsburgh Pirates dueling the Los Angeles Dodgers on Monday at Dodger Stadium.
The match puts starter Trevor Williams for the Pittsburgh Pirates on the hill facing Brandon McCarthy for the Los Angeles Dodgers. Williams brings a 1-1 mark to the game, while McCarthy is 3-0 to date on the season.

Statistical Matchup
The game also pits Los Angeles Dodgers No. 12-rated offense, averaging 4.74 runs per game, against a Pittsburgh Pirates defense that ranks No. 12 at 4.35 in runs allowed per game. The Los Angeles Dodgers have averaged 8.39 hits per game so far, more than Pittsburgh Pirates batters have averaged on the year (7.84 hits per game).
Defensively, Pittsburgh features the No. 3-rated defense on the road, allowing 3.63 runs per game. Los Angeles, meanwhile, comes in at No. 6 at home, scoring 5.31 runs per game.
